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Turmi features a tropical savanna climate (Aw). Temperatures typically range between 25 °C (78 °F) and 28 °C (83 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to 18 °C (65 °F) or can rise to as high as 39 °C (102 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 777 mm (30.6 inches) and receives 109 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Turmi enjoys an average of 3969 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 11 hours 49 minutes to 12 hours 23 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Turmi, Ethiopia

The warmest months in Turmi are January, February and March,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 27 to 28 °C (82 - 83 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in June, July and November, when daily mean temperatures range from 25 to 26 °C (78 - 79 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Turmi experiences 325 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 0 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Turmi, Ethiopia

Turmi usually has the most precipitation in April, May and October, with an average of 15 rainy days and 114 mm (4.5 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Turmi are January, February and August. On average, 22 mm (0.9 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ly average precipitation and precipitation days in Turmi. Generated using Copernicus Climate Change Service information. Data for period from January 2017 to January 2022.
 JanFebMarAprMayJunJulAugSepOctNovDec
Average precipitation mm (inches)14 (0.6)25 (1.0)74 (2.9)143 (5.6)89 (3.5)53 (2.1)70 (2.7)28 (1.1)41 (1.6)109 (4.3)88 (3.5)42 (1.6)
Average precipitation days (≥ 1 mm)24112012685715136

Monthly sunshine hours in Turmi, Ethiopia

The sunniest months in Turmi are March, August and December, when the sun shines an average of 11 hours 10 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Turmi: January, February and April receive an average of 10 hours 10 minutes of sunshine daily.

Mean monthly sunshine duration, average sunshine hours per day and mean daily daylight hours in Turmi. Generated using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service information. Data for period from January 2017 to January 2022.
 JanFebMarAprMayJunJulAugSepOctNovDec
Mean monthly sunshine hours280313344321343334337348338334326346
Mean daily daylight hours11h 51m11h 57m12h 4m12h 12m12h 20m12h 23m12h 21m12h 15m12h 7m11h 59m11h 52m11h 49m
